October 2003, and five months into a newly-elected council, North Devon DC was labelled as 'weak'. It was a tough time, with local newspapers carrying damning front-page headlines. We went through the usual process - disbelief, anger, denial and finally, acceptance. Next came the improvement plan. We included 19 projects targeted at weaknesses identified in the CPA report. There were some service-based projects, but most were about corporate capacity and management. It was a three-year plan, franked informally by the Audit Commission, and resourced in part with £170,000 from the ODPM Capacity Building Fund. We gave our plan a dear brand and promoted it strongly with staff and members, with regular updates through monthly newsletters and face-to-face briefings by the leader and myself.
